Output 25daf91719712fb8a049954283e91bb019758668135c2bcc30e0a8249d19a092:20

value
4052114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d022ce8c694d8f4299c7c37a9f1f861fc7d5aec0 OP_EQUAL
address
3LfYAs9YzkA2DrD9W64muhNQkTh2pQnSnK
transaction
25daf91719712fb8a049954283e91bb019758668135c2bcc30e0a8249d19a092